诗篇 7
Chinese Contemporary Bible (Simplified)
求上帝伸张正义
大卫向耶和华唱的诗,与便雅悯人古实有关。
7 我的上帝耶和华啊,我投靠你,
求你拯救我脱离追赶我的人。
2 别让他们像狮子般撕裂我,
无人搭救。
3 我的上帝耶和华啊,
倘若我犯了罪,
手上沾了不义;
4 倘若我恩将仇报,
无故抢夺仇敌,
5 就让仇敌追上我,
践踏我,使我声名扫地。(细拉)
6 耶和华啊,
求你发怒攻击我暴怒的仇敌。
我的上帝啊,
求你来伸张正义。
7 愿万民环绕你,
愿你从高天治理他们,
8 愿你审判万民!
至高的耶和华啊,
我是公义正直的,
求你为我主持公道。
9 鉴察人心肺腑的公义上帝啊,
求你铲除邪恶,扶持义人。
10 上帝是我的盾牌,
祂拯救心地正直的人。
11 上帝是公义的审判官,
天天向恶人发怒。
12 他们若不悔改,祂必磨刀霍霍,
弯弓搭箭,诛灭他们。
13 祂准备好了夺命的兵器,
火箭已在弦上。
14 恶人心怀恶念,
居心叵测,滋生虚谎。
15 他们挖了陷阱,却自陷其中。
16 他们的恶行临到自己头上,
他们的暴力落到自己脑壳上。
17 我要称谢耶和华的公义,
我要歌颂至高者耶和华的名。

Psalm 7
King James Version
7 O Lord my God, in thee do I put my trust: save me from all them that persecute me, and deliver me:
2 Lest he tear my soul like a lion, rending it in pieces, while there is none to deliver.
3 O Lord my God, If I have done this; if there be iniquity in my hands;
4 If I have rewarded evil unto him that was at peace with me; (yea, I have delivered him that without cause is mine enemy:)
5 Let the enemy persecute my soul, and take it; yea, let him tread down my life upon the earth, and lay mine honour in the dust. Selah.
6 Arise, O Lord, in thine anger, lift up thyself because of the rage of mine enemies: and awake for me to the judgment that thou hast commanded.
7 So shall the congregation of the people compass thee about: for their sakes therefore return thou on high.
8 The Lord shall judge the people: judge me, O Lord, according to my righteousness, and according to mine integrity that is in me.
9 Oh let the wickedness of the wicked come to an end; but establish the just: for the righteous God trieth the hearts and reins.
10 My defence is of God, which saveth the upright in heart.
11 God judgeth the righteous, and God is angry with the wicked every day.
12 If he turn not, he will whet his sword; he hath bent his bow, and made it ready.
13 He hath also prepared for him the instruments of death; he ordaineth his arrows against the persecutors.
14 Behold, he travaileth with iniquity, and hath conceived mischief, and brought forth falsehood.
15 He made a pit, and digged it, and is fallen into the ditch which he made.
16 His mischief shall return upon his own head, and his violent dealing shall come down upon his own pate.
17 I will praise the Lord according to his righteousness: and will sing praise to the name of the Lord most high.
